>   I'm also surprized that Saxon indents HTML output by default in the
> absence of an xsl:output directive asking for such a transformation.

Concerning the html output method, the XSLT Rec. says:

  If the indent attribute has the value yes, then the html output
  method may add or remove whitespace as it outputs the result tree,
  so long as it does not change how an HTML user agent would render
  the output. The default value is yes.

So I think that it's legal for Saxon to add indentation at this top
level; of course it's also legal not to.

> Last point is that when using the HTML output method, using
> xsl:processing-instruction is NOT equivalent to what Roel Vanhout
> was specifying, the spec says that the HTML serialization should
> terminate PI with '>' and not '?>' as the CDATA section suggested.

Good point.
